Problema con la propiedades de Documet.all

kachu
09 de Agosto del 2003
Hola.
Estoy intentado mover una capa en JavaScript y el problema que tengo es que cuando intento averguar la posicion del objeto en esta caso un div, me dice siempre que es 0.
El div coge su estilo desde una hoja de estilos, y para obtener la posicion utilizo:
document.all[Nombre].style.posTop, o pixelTop, que son la propiedades que utilizo para moverlo.

Que pudo hacer para saber la posicion en la que estaba antes de moverlo que siempre me dice que es 0, aunque en la hoja de estilo lo pongo a 50.

Juan
09 de Agosto del 2003
posTop y posLeft devuelven s贸lo sirven si el div est谩
en posici贸n absoluta y si no es as铆 devuelven 0.
Para calcular la posici贸n en elementos con posicionamiento
relativo usa offSetLeft y offSetTop, que son propiedades
del objeto, no atributos del style.